Social Media and Digital Culture Shifts

Social media continues to evolve rapidly, and teenagers trends 2026 reflect this constant change. Short-form video content remains dominant, but the platforms hosting it look different than they did just two years ago.

Decentralized social networks are gaining traction among teens who want more control over their data. These platforms offer alternatives to algorithm-driven feeds. Young users increasingly value authenticity over polished content.

AI-generated content creates new conversations about what’s “real” online. Teens in 2026 show growing interest in platforms that verify human creators. Trust matters more than ever in digital spaces.

Private group chats and smaller community spaces are replacing massive public followings as the preferred way to connect. Teens gravitate toward close-knit digital circles rather than broadcasting to thousands. This shift represents one of the most significant teenagers trends 2026 will bring.

Content creation tools become more accessible. Many teens now produce professional-quality videos using just their phones. The barrier between consumer and creator continues to shrink.

Digital literacy also takes center stage. Schools and parents push for better education about online safety, misinformation, and healthy social media habits. Teens themselves advocate for more transparency from platforms about how their data gets used.

Fashion and Style Predictions

Fashion-focused teenagers trends 2026 blend sustainability with self-expression. Thrift shopping and secondhand marketplaces remain popular choices for budget-conscious and eco-aware teens.

Y2K aesthetics continue their comeback, but with fresh twists. Low-rise fits, bold colors, and chunky accessories dominate teen wardrobes. Vintage pieces mixed with modern basics create unique personal styles.

Gender-neutral clothing lines expand across major retailers. Teens increasingly reject strict dress codes based on gender. Comfort and individual expression drive purchasing decisions more than traditional fashion rules.

Sneaker culture shows no signs of slowing down. Limited releases and collaborations between brands and artists fuel excitement. Many teens view sneakers as investment pieces and collectibles.

DIY fashion gains momentum as teenagers trends 2026 embrace customization. Patches, embroidery, and hand-painted designs let teens make mass-produced items feel personal. Social media tutorials make these skills accessible to anyone with basic supplies.

Sustainability influences buying habits in meaningful ways. Teens research brands before purchasing and favor companies with transparent environmental practices. Fast fashion faces growing criticism from this generation.

Technology and Entertainment Preferences

Technology shapes daily life for teens, and teenagers trends 2026 showcase new preferences in devices and entertainment.

Gaming remains a central social activity. Multiplayer experiences and virtual hangout spaces attract millions of young users daily. The line between gaming and social media blurs as platforms integrate more communication features.

AI tools become standard resources for assignments, creative projects, and problem-solving. Teens use these tools casually but also develop critical thinking about their limitations. Schools adapt curricula to address AI literacy.

Streaming services face new competition from user-generated content platforms. Many teens prefer watching creators they relate to over traditional TV shows or movies. Podcast consumption also rises among older teens seeking deeper discussions on topics they care about.

Wearable technology expands beyond fitness trackers. Smart rings, AR glasses, and health-monitoring devices appeal to tech-forward teenagers. These gadgets serve practical purposes while also functioning as fashion accessories.

Virtual reality experiences improve in quality and accessibility. Teenagers trends 2026 include more VR concerts, social spaces, and educational applications. The technology moves from novelty to everyday use for many young people.

Screen time conversations continue as parents and teens negotiate healthy boundaries. Many families establish tech-free zones or times to maintain balance.

Mental Health and Wellness Priorities

Mental health awareness defines many teenagers trends 2026. This generation speaks openly about anxiety, depression, and stress in ways previous generations rarely did.

Mindfulness apps designed specifically for teens see increased downloads. Guided meditations, breathing exercises, and mood tracking help young people manage daily pressures. Schools incorporate these tools into health curricula.

Physical fitness takes diverse forms beyond traditional sports. Dance workouts, hiking, yoga, and home exercise routines appeal to teens seeking movement without competition pressure. Wellness becomes personal rather than performance-based.

Sleep hygiene gains attention as teens recognize the connection between rest and mental clarity. Many adopt routines that limit screen time before bed and create better sleep environments.

Peer support networks grow in importance. Teens train as mental health advocates in their schools and communities. They create safe spaces for conversations that adults sometimes struggle to help.

Therapy loses its stigma among young people. Teenagers trends 2026 show more teens actively seeking professional support and encouraging friends to do the same. Online therapy options make access easier for those in underserved areas.

Social media’s impact on mental health prompts real action. Many teens take intentional breaks from platforms or curate their feeds to reduce negative content exposure.
